Responsibilities
- Manage Calendars: Coordinate and schedule appointments, meetings, and patient visits efficiently.
- Communication: Receive and screen incoming calls and emails, directing them to the appropriate staff members promptly.
- Data Entry: Maintain accurate records in our scheduling software and CRM systems.
- Conflict Resolution: Handle rescheduling requests and address scheduling conflicts with a professional and solution-oriented approach.
- Client Relations: Provide exceptional customer service to ensure a positive experience for all callers and visitors.
- Reporting: Assist in generating daily and weekly reports on schedule utilization and occupancy.
